Bengaluru & 14 Karnataka Districts on Yellow Alert as Rains Set to Continue Till April 17


Bengaluru, April 16 Residents across Karnataka, including Bengaluru, should gear up for more rain, as the India Meteorological Department (IMD) has issued a Yellow Alert in effect until April 17. Expect light to moderate rainfall, thunderstorms, lightning, and gusty winds in several parts of the state.

🔹 What’s in the Forecast?

  • Partly cloudy skies with one or two spells of rain and thundershowers expected in Bengaluru on April 16.
  • Wind speeds may range between 30–50 km/h, increasing the risk of gusty conditions.
  • The alert follows recent thunderstorms and showers across north and west Bengaluru.


Furthermore, the IMD has flagged the following 15 districts for weather-related caution, urging people to stay vigilant.

  • Bengaluru Urban & Rural
  • Shimoga, Davangere, Chitradurga
  • Chikmagalur, Bellary, Tumkur
  • Mandya, Hassan, Kodagu
  • Mysore, Chamarajanagar, Ramnagar, Kolar

☁️ Bengaluru Weather Highlights (April 15)

  • 102 wards reported rainfall.
  • 6.2 mm of rain was recorded at Palace Road observatory by 8:30 pm.
  • The heaviest showers occurred between 5:30 pm and 7:30 pm.
  • Gusty winds were reported across multiple areas.

⚠️ IMD & KSNDMC Advisory:

  • Rain expected in coastal, Malnad, and southern interior districts.
  • Northern districts may see light rain or isolated drizzles.
  • Therefore, residents are advised to stay indoors during thunderstorms and avoid unnecessary travel during evening hours.
